Partnerships with Scouting Serving the Community

On Saturday 19 April 2008 we are holding a Forum on ‘Partnerships with Scouting Serving the Community’. It provides an opportunity to explore together how we can build partnerships to help serve all young people within our communities. Please register your interest in participating in the forum here.
The Forum will address the ways in which the adventure, fun and challenge of Scouting can be used to engage with young people who currently are not involved in community-based youth programmes. Delegates will include educationalists, community leaders and youth agencies. The Forum will provide an opportunity to hear about initiatives underway to deliver Scouting in different ways. There is no charge to participate in the forum.
